Summary
California lawmakers are advancing legislation to restrict the eligibility of mentally ill defendants for alternative sentencing options, in response to a string of violent crimes. The bill, backed by prosecutors, aims to ensure that those deemed a danger to society are held accountable for their actions.
Why It Matters
This legislation reflects growing concerns about public safety and the judicial system’s handling of mentally ill individuals. By tightening qualifications for mental health off-ramps, lawmakers hope to balance compassion with accountability in criminal justice.
